Rangers Win Four In-A-Row On Home Ice

February 11, 2011 - Ontario Hockey League (OHL)
Kitchener Rangers News Release


Jason Akeson's five points led the Kitchener Rangers to a 7-1 victory over the Sarnia Sting.

Tobias Rieder scored on a shot to the top of the Sting's net at 3:28 that gave the Rangers a 1-0 lead. Less than a minute later, Gabriel Landeskog fed the puck to Ryan Murphy who scored his 22nd of the season to make it 2-0. Akeson buried a one-timer at the 14:19 mark to put Kitchener up by 3-0. Rieder closed first period scoring 4-0 Rangers with his second of the game at 17:01.

Akeson marked his second goal of the evening at 0:45 of the second period. He deflected a Cody Sol shot past the Sting's Troy Passingham. Tyler Randell made it 6-0 Kitchener after he netted a backhander at the 2:59 mark. The remainder of the period was scoreless.

Jerry D'Amigo backhanded his third goal of the season past Sarnia netminder Brandon Hope at the midway mark of the third period to up the score 7-0 Kitchener. The Sting's Jack Kuzmyk put an end to Rangers' goaltender Mike Morrison's shutout bid with a goal at 13:01.
